Nutrients of N and P are material foundation to the survival of Marine life, theircontents and distributions directly affect the marine primary productivity and thehealth of ecosystem. Due to the particularity of the estuary environment, thebiogeochemistry of nutrient in estuaries is complicated, and the composition,distribution and transformation of nutrients are usually affected by multiple factorssuch as physical, chemical and biological processes. In addition, strong humanactivities interfere with nutrients to the river and sea, which greatly threaten themarine ecological environment. The temperal and spacial distributions of variousnutrients were studied in the Shuangtaizi River Estuary, as well as the transportationand transformation, budgets and associated factors. The results will be helpful on theutilization of water resources and coastal ecological environment, and management onthe water pollutant and prevention of eutrophication in estuary.In order to analysis the distribution of nutrients in Shuangtazi River Estuary,different forms of nutrients in the water were collected in October2010(autumn),May2011(spring), and August2011(summer). The results show that NO3-N(averagedat220.94,198.23and131.30μmol/L) was the predominant species of DIN, more than75%; DIN was the predominant species of TN(averaged at271.53,241.48and176.52μmol/L), accounted for about80%; while the propotion of PO4-P of TP(3.11,4.05and4.85μmol/L) was closed to DOP and PP, it was about30%. Due to the change ofrunoff and biological process in the estuary, the concentrations of DIN, TN, PP and TPvaried with sesons, but the others had changed little. In autumn, the high value ofmost nutrients always appeared in central region of the channel, and decreased to theseawtater member, but the chang trend of DON and DOP was not obvious. In spring,the high value of most nutrients appeared on the top of the river, and decreased to themixed member and seawater member. In summer the distribution characteristics ofnutrients decreased from freshwater member to seawater member, but the chang trendof PN and PO4-P was not obvious. The high value of nutrients was appeared at the intersection of rivers and offshore area. The concentrations of nutrients in the surferwere closed to the bottom.The effects of environmental factors (such as salinity, chlorophyll a, DO and TSS,etc.) on distributions and migration process of nutrients were analysed. The resultsshow that the runoff was the main source of nutrients, but PO4-P and DOP contributedby the rleasing from particulate matter besides. NO3-N and TN behavedconservatively, and their transformations mainly controlled by the dilution of seawaterand freshwater mixing; NH4-N, NO2-N, DON and PN showed not conservative, theirbehaviors were related to biological transformation process. NH4-N and NO2-N wereadded, while DON and PN were removed. PP and TP behaved conservatively, theywere mainly controlled by dilution in the mixing process. DOP and PO4-P did notbehaved conservatively, and they were mainly controlled by the sediment releasingand biological transformation process. PO4-P and DOP were added, while TP and PPdid not appear to add or remove obvioursly. SiO3-Si was added slightly by sedimentrleasing in the mixing process, and its behavior was partial conservative. Thedissolved nutrients had poor correlation with Chl a, so biological effect on thetransformations of nutrients was not obvious. Relative to character, biological effectson Si was greater than N and P. Other factors had no significant effect on nutrients, itneeds further research.Simple box model was used to estimate water-mass balance and nutrients bugetsin Shuangtaizi River estuary. The data suggested that the balance flux (ΔT) of NO2-N、NH4-N, NO3-N, DON, PN, TN, PO4-P, DOP, PP, TP and SiO3-Si were700.3,573.3,276.5,118.5,279.9,1151.6,29.2,92.5,39.8,161.5, and2449.1T/a, respectively. Itwas learnt from the result that Shuangtaizi River Estuary was the sink of DON and PN,and was the source of other nutrients. Primary productivity in shallow water wasestimated to be about5396.6t C/a. Then primary producers consumed814.6t DINand814.6t PO4-P every year, that accouted for1/7and5/8of DIN and PO4-P flux,respectively. The nutrients flux can fully meet the needs of the nearshore primaryproductivity, and had a spare for the open sea.The nutritional status of Shuangtaizi River Estuary were analyzed, the results show that the structure of nutrients was imbalance, dissolved inorganic N/P, Si/N andSi/P was130.6,0.8and130.6, respectively, but the absolute concentrations ofnutrients were higher, there is no problem of nutrients limitation. Other forms of N/Pratio had big difference, man-made pollution and fertiliser using greatly interfereswith the different forms of N/P ratio in Shuangtaizi River estuary. The eutrophicationcondition of Shuangtaizi River was very serious, the nutritional indexs (E) were42.4,79.4and33.8in Autuam, Spring and Summer, respectively, averaged at51.8, faraboved the eutrophication standard. At the same time, the flux of P and Si was lesserthan N, which may cause potential nutrients limitation. So it should be paid moreattention to.
